CPCA: An efficient wireless routing algorithm in WiNoC for cross path congestion awareness |
| |
Affiliation: | 1. School of Computer and Information, Hefei University of Technology, 193 Tunxi Road, Hefei 230009, China;2. School of Electronic Science and Applied Physics, Hefei University of Technology, 193 Tunxi Road, Hefei 230009, China;1. College of Computer, National University of Defense Technology, Changsha, 410073, China;2. State Key Laboratory of High Performance Computing, National University of Defense Technology, Changsha, 410073, China;3. Department of Electrical and Computer Engineering, University of Pittsburgh, Pittsburgh, PA 15261, USA;4. Department of Computer Science, University of Pittsburgh, Pittsburgh, PA 15260, USA;1. STMicroelectronics, Pobrezni 620/3, 18600 Prague 8, Czech Republic;2. Department of Microelectronics, Faculty of Electrical Engineering, Czech Technical University in Prague, Technicka 2, 16627 Prague 6, Czech Republic |
| |
Abstract: | Wireless network-on-chip (WiNoC) is a new paradigm to mitigate the long-distance transmission latency for conventional wired network-on-chip. The wireless routers in WiNoC have to handle a large number of packets which could cause data congestion, thus reducing the network performance. In this paper, we propose a novel wireless routing algorithm, called CPCA, which exploits the cross path congestion information as hints to route the packets. Under CPCA, the whole network is partitioned into sub-networks. In each subnet, the congestion information of the wireless router is propagated along the cross path. As a result, the routers in the same dimension can get the congestion degree of wireless router within the subnet. Based on the congestion information, CPCA can compute the suitable path for packets routing, which can prominently avoid the congestion aggravation in the wireless router. Experimental results show that our proposed method can effectively improve performance in terms of packets transmission latency and network throughput. |
| |
Keywords: | Wireless network-on-chip Routing algorithm Congestion awareness Wireless router |
本文献已被 ScienceDirect 等数据库收录! |
|